178 Neb. Admin. Code, ch. 1, § 005 - TOILET FACILITIES

Toilet facilities shall be provided at the ratio of not less than one seat for every ten (10) campers. In camps occupied by males and where urinals are used, one toilet seat shall be provided for every fifteen (15) male occupants, and one urinal for every thirty (30) male occupants. Toilet buildings or rooms shall be conveniently located, well lighted and ventilated, kept in good repair, and, when in use, kept in a clean and sanitary condition. Toilet rooms shall not open directly into any room in which food, drink, or utensils are handled or stored. The entrance of all toilet facilities shall be designed to permit privacy. Toilet facilities located adjacent to food-related operations shall be fully enclosed.
